About Esperance Anglican Community School
Esperance Anglican Community School is a independent secondary school located in Esperance, Western Australia. The school offers education for students from 7-12.
With 308 students enrolled in 2025 and an ICSEA score of 1004 (49th percentile), the school serves a community with above-average socio-educational advantage. The student-to-teacher ratio of 14:1 supports quality learning outcomes.
